Durham Cathedral stands proudly above the River Wear, a breathtaking symbol of faith, history and architectural brilliance. Built in the late 11th century, this UNESCO World Heritage Site is widely regarded as one of the finest examples of Norman architecture in Europe, with its soaring nave, dramatic stone vaulting and timeless presence.
At the heart of the city for nearly a thousand years, Durham Cathedral remains a living place of worship while welcoming visitors from around the world. Whether admired from afar or explored within, it offers a powerful sense of peace, heritage and awe that defines Durham itself.
